Virginia National Bankshares Corporation (VABK), a regional banking institution operating primarily across Virginia markets, is trading at $43.6 as of May 5, 2026, marking a 2.11% gain in recent trading sessions. This analysis breaks down key technical levels, prevailing sector context, and potential near-term scenarios for the stock, as market participants weigh both broad macroeconomic trends and idiosyncratic technical signals for regional banking names.
